Leicester vs Tottenham Preview

Leicester City’s Battle for Stability

The 2024/25 Premier League season kicks off with Leicester City, the 2016 champions, returning to the top flight after a season in the Championship.

The Foxes face a challenging season ahead, not just due to their status as a newly-promoted team but also due to a looming points deduction related to breaches of Profit and Sustainability rules.

Adding to the complexity, Leicester have introduced Steve Cooper as their new manager, marking their third managerial change in as many seasons.

Despite the controversy surrounding his appointment—stemming from his past association with Leicester’s rivals Nottingham Forest—Cooper’s unbeaten record in his debut matches at previous clubs (W1, D1) provides a glimmer of hope.

However, his personal record against Tottenham Hotspur, with three losses in four meetings by a two-goal margin, casts a shadow over this optimism.

Tottenham Hotspur’s Quest for Consistency Under Postecoglou

On the other side, Tottenham Hotspur enter the second year of the Ange Postecoglou era, looking to improve on their previous season’s early promise which ultimately resulted in a fifth-place finish.

The acquisition of Dominic Solanke for £65m highlights Spurs’ ambitions, as Postecoglou aims to replicate the success he enjoyed in the second years of his previous managerial stints.

Despite these high hopes, Spurs must navigate early challenges, notably the suspension of Yves Bissouma for misconduct. Additionally, their poor form in away games towards the end of last season (W1, D1, L4) highlights areas needing significant improvement.

Key Players to Watch

Abdul Fatawu (Leicester City)

Having made his move from Sporting permanent, the young Ghanaian winger is expected to play a crucial role for Leicester.

Fatawu’s knack for scoring crucial early goals, as evidenced by his performances last season, will be vital for Leicester’s hopes.

Dominic Solanke (Tottenham Hotspur)

Labelled as the potential “signing of the season” by Ian Wright, Solanke’s prolific scoring form, including 19 league goals last season for Bournemouth, makes him one to watch. His history of scoring against Leicester adds an intriguing subplot to the match.

Conclusion: A Clash of Ambitions and Challenges

As Leicester City and Tottenham Hotspur face off in the first Monday Night Football of the season, both teams come with their own set of ambitions and challenges.

Leicester are aiming for stability and survival amidst managerial changes and regulatory challenges, while Tottenham are focused on building consistency under Postecoglou’s leadership and integrating high-profile new signings effectively.

This match not only sets the tone for their seasons but also tests their readiness to tackle the long and demanding Premier League campaign ahead.
